The closed Brayton cycle system, which can control the output power by increasing and decreasing the amount of working fluid without changing the rotational speed, is discussed. The 10 kWe engine system under development has high pressure ratio. The system operating point is discussed, and the turbine, compressor, gas bearings, and engine construction are described. Some experiments have been carried out for this system, and start-stop transient and steady-state operating data have been obtained.
Development of closed Brayton cycle engine for solar power LOX/LH2 production system
